Q1: The Nusselt number for fully developed (both thermally and hydrodynamically) laminar flow through a circular pipe whose surface temperature remains constant isA 1.66
B 88.66
C 3.66
D dependent on NRe only
ANS:C - 3.66 For fully developed laminar flow through a circular pipe with constant surface temperature, the Nusselt number (Nu) can be determined using the following correlation: =3.66Nu=3.66 This correlation is derived from the Graetz solution for laminar flow in a circular pipe with constant surface temperature boundary conditions. It represents the average Nusselt number for the entire length of the pipe under fully developed conditions. Therefore, the correct answer is 3.66. |
